Cement-Free Concrete's Promise

The construction industry is exploring innovative solutions to reduce its carbon footprint. One such groundbreaking development is cement-free concrete, a material that offers a significantly diminished environmental impact. Traditionally, cement production is responsible for considerable greenhouse gas emissions. Cement-free concrete, however, relies on alternative materials such as industrial byproducts to achieve equivalent strength and durability. Exploring Beyond Cement: Possibilities of Low Carbon Concrete

Cement production is a major contributor to global carbon emissions. Thankfully, the construction industry is actively exploring innovative solutions to reduce its environmental impact. Low-carbon concrete, a promising substitute, offers a path toward more sustainable building practices. This revolutionary material utilizes supplementary materials like fly ash, slag, and recycled aggregates to decrease the reliance on traditional cement, thereby lowering carbon emissions throughout its lifecycle.
